WebNov 28, 2010 · The decision is made when the socket is bound. When bind is called, the address you specify determines the interface the socket will listen on. (Or even all interfaces.) Even if you don't use bind, it happens implicitly when you connect. WebSep 3, 2024 · A NIC is a computer expansion card for connecting to a network (e.g., home network or Internet) using an Ethernet cable with an RJ-45 connector. Due to the popularity and low cost of the Ethernet standard, nearly all new computers have a network interface build directly into the motherboard. Click the + next to Network and highlight Adapter. The right side of the window should display complete information about the network card. Note WebFeb 3, 2024 · Right-click the Start button. Open Device Manager. With Device Manager open, look for the network adapters category and expand it by selecting the small “ + ” or arrow symbol if it isn’t already open. Look for the network adapter in question—Right-click on it and select Properties.
